Still Life with Vase and Fruit is a 1898 oil by Pedro Alexandrino Borges, a Post-Impressionism work, depicting Fruit, held at São Paulo Museum of Art.
This painting shows a still life with a vase and fruit. The vase is white with green leaves and stems painted on it. It sits on a table with a plate of fruit in front of it. There's a pineapple, bananas, and other fruits on the plate. Some of the fruit is on the table, too. A bag of fruit is tied up with a red cloth next to the plate. The background is dark brown. The fruit looks fresh and colorful. The vase has a unique design with the green leaves and stems. The painting has a lot of details, like the texture of the fruit and the folds in the cloth. The painting is held at the São Paulo Museum of Art.
Pedro Alexandrino Borges (1856–1942) was an artist, born in São Paulo.
